GLOUCESTER PARK   13 May 2025
 
GOING: G

TROTSYND- JOIN THE FUN MS PACE 2130m

Track: GOOD      

ATLANTIC GEM (8) resumes from a spell of five months after closing off last campaign in good form, the last run being a solid third over 1730m at this track. Must overcome a very wide draw but is sure to prove hard to beat on her return. PETES HONOUR (7) was 4.5 metres away in second here over 2130m last start at his first run back from a spell. Meets a comparable field so he can certainly take this out. ROX THE WORLD (9) is worth plenty of thought off a last-start win by 5 metres at Narrogin over 2242m. Top-three aspirations. TOMMY PRICE (1) should not have any excuses from the favourable draw and cannot be underestimated.
